Skip to main content
Feedback

2025-01 Google Ads upgrade v19

This changelog outlines the key updates in the transition from Google Ads API v17 to v19, including new features, reports, fields, and filters, along with deprecated and removed components. It’s designed to help users and analysts quickly identify changes and ensure a smooth migration.

All updates are organized by category, based on Google's official upgrade documentation.

New additions

Reports Added

  • Data Link
  • Performance Max Placement View
  • Offline Conversion Upload Conversion Action Summary
  • Content Criterion View

Fields & filters added

  • ad.demand_gen_multi_asset_ad.tall_portrait_marketing_images
  • ad.video_ad.audio
  • ad.app_ad.app_deep_link

Ad Group

  • ad_group.demand_gen_ad_group_settings.channel_controls.channel_config
  • ad_group.demand_gen_ad_group_settings.channel_controls.channel_strategy
  • ad_group.demand_gen_ad_group_settings.channel_controls.selected_channels.*
  • ad_group.exclude_demographic_expansion
  • ad_group.fixed_cpm_micros
  • ad_group.target_cpv_micros

Campaign

  • campaign.video_campaign_settings.video_ad_inventory_control.allow_in_feed
  • campaign.video_campaign_settings.video_ad_inventory_control.allow_in_stream
  • campaign.video_campaign_settings.video_ad_inventory_control.allow_shorts
  • campaign.fixed_cpm.target_frequency_info.target_count
  • campaign.fixed_cpm.target_frequency_info.time_unit
  • campaign.brand_guidelines.accent_color
  • campaign.brand_guidelines.main_color
  • campaign.brand_guidelines.predefined_font_family
  • campaign.brand_guidelines_enabled
  • campaign.pmax_campaign_settings.brand_targeting_overrides.ignore_exclusions_for_shopping_ads

Customer

  • customer.image_asset_auto_migration_done_date_time
  • customer.location_asset_auto_migration_done_date_time
  • customer.local_services_settings.granular_insurance_statuses
  • customer.local_services_settings.granular_license_statuses

Metrics & Segments

  • metrics.biddable_cohort_app_post_install_conversions
  • segments.ad_format_type
  • segments.travel_destination_city
  • segments.travel_destination_country
  • segments.travel_destination_region
  • asset.app_deep_link_asset.app_deep_link_uri
  • asset.business_message_asset.call_to_action.*
  • asset.business_message_asset.message_provider
  • asset.business_message_asset.whatsapp_info.*

Deprecations & removals

Reports removed

  • ad_group_extension_setting
  • ad_group_feed
  • campaign_extension_setting
  • campaign_feed
  • customer_extension_setting
  • customer_feed
  • extension_feed_item
  • feed
  • feed_item
  • feed_item_set
  • feed_item_set_link
  • feed_item_target
  • feed_mapping
  • feed_placeholder_view

Fields removed (Examples)

Over 100+ fields removed from deprecated reports. Key removals include:

Extension feed items

  • extension_feed_item.ad_schedules
  • extension_feed_item.callout_feed_item.callout_text
  • extension_feed_item.sitelink_feed_item.final_urls
  • extension_feed_item.promotion_feed_item.promotion_code

Feed & feed items

  • feed.id, feed.name, feed.origin
  • feed_item.attribute_values
  • feed_item.geo_targeting_restriction

Feed mapping & placeholder view

  • feed_mapping.attribute_field_mappings
  • feed_placeholder_view.placeholder_type

Enum changes

  • Removed: VIDEO_OUTSTREAM from:

    • AdGroupType
    • AdType
    • AdvertisingChannelSubType
  • Renamed:

    • DISCOVERY_CAROUSEL_CARDDEMAND_GEN_CAROUSEL_CARD

Summary table

CategoryDetails
Reports Added3 new reports introduced
Fields AddedExtensive across Ad, Campaign, Customer, Assets
Reports Deprecated14 legacy reports removed
Fields RemovedOver 100+, mostly related to feed & extension systems
Enum Changes1 removed, 1 renamed

For technical details and migration best practices, refer to the official upgrade guide.

On this Page